Transaction 79af79055e9d5b7df98da3608e4e652b58c16e4310700d08070a6eb9aae526a5

7 Input
2 Outputs
  • 79af79055e9d5b7df98da3608e4e652b58c16e4310700d08070a6eb9aae526a5:0
  • value  50000000
    address  1FM9qpUXbtMPo2Yx88S9CHUi5fCakkGEjo
  • 79af79055e9d5b7df98da3608e4e652b58c16e4310700d08070a6eb9aae526a5:1
  • value  9766383
    address  3QFCPzV9Y4hKKtMLktPJcNMmB8mzq8ShQ9